Key Features to Look For

When you shop for Giant Schnauzer puppy food, look for a few main things. These features help support their rapid growth and developing joints.

  • **High-Quality Protein Source:** Look for real meat like chicken, lamb, or fish listed as the first ingredient. Protein builds strong muscles.
  • **Controlled Calcium and Phosphorus:** Giant breeds grow very fast. Too much calcium can cause bone problems. The food must have balanced levels for large breed puppies.
  • **DHA for Brain Development:** This healthy fat, often from fish oil, helps your puppy learn and see clearly.
  • **Appropriate Kibble Size:** The pieces of food should be large enough so the puppy chews them well, not just swallows them whole.
Important Ingredients and Materials

The best food uses good, whole materials. Avoid foods filled with junk.

The main ingredients should be named meats. Good carbohydrates like sweet potatoes or brown rice provide energy. Healthy fats, like those from flaxseed or fish oil, keep their coat shiny. You want to see added vitamins and minerals that support bone health, such as Glucosamine and Chondroitin, especially in larger breed formulas.

Artificial colors, flavors, and cheap fillers like corn gluten meal or by-products should be avoided. These add little nutritional value to your growing giant.

Factors That Affect Food Quality

What makes one bag of food better than another? It comes down to formulation and processing.

Improving Quality:
  • **Life Stage Specificity:** Always choose food labeled “For Large Breed Puppies.” This ensures the nutrient balance is correct for their slower, more controlled growth rate.
  • **Natural Preservation:** Foods preserved naturally with Vitamin E (mixed tocopherols) are higher quality than those using chemical preservatives like BHA or BHT.
  • **Whole Food Inclusion:** Foods that include real vegetables and fruits offer more natural vitamins.
Reducing Quality:

Low-quality food often uses vague terms like “meat meal” without specifying the animal source. Foods with excessive amounts of corn or wheat as the primary ingredient often offer less usable nutrition for a growing puppy.

10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Giant Schnauzer Puppy Food

Q: How much should I feed my Giant Schnauzer puppy?

A: Always follow the feeding chart on the specific food bag. This chart uses your puppy’s expected adult weight to calculate daily portions. You must adjust this based on your puppy’s activity level.

Q: When should I switch from puppy food to adult food?

A: Giant Schnauzers usually finish growing around 18 months to 2 years old. Consult your veterinarian, but most large breed puppies switch to adult large breed formula between 15 and 18 months.

Q: Can I feed regular large breed puppy food to my Giant Schnauzer?

A: Yes, if the food is specifically designed for “Large Breeds.” Standard puppy food often has too much fat and too many calories, causing Giant Schnauzers to grow too fast.

Q: Is grain-free food better for Giant Schnauzers?

A: Not necessarily. Many healthy grains provide needed energy. Focus on the quality of ingredients, not just whether the food is grain-free or not.

Q: Why is my puppy constantly hungry even after eating?

A: This might mean the food is low in quality nutrients, and the puppy is not feeling full. Try increasing the meal frequency or switching to a food with higher quality, more digestible protein.

Q: How often should I feed my young puppy?

A: Puppies under six months generally need three meals a day. After six months, you can usually reduce this to two measured meals per day.

Q: What ingredients should I definitely avoid in puppy food?

A: Avoid artificial colors, chemical preservatives (like BHA/BHT), and excessive amounts of unknown animal by-products.

Q: Does the kibble size matter for this breed?

A: Yes. The kibble should be large enough to encourage chewing. Small kibble can be swallowed too fast, leading to gulping air or choking.

Q: How do I transition to a new food without upsetting my puppy’s stomach?

A: Mix the new food slowly into the old food over 7 to 10 days. Start with 25% new food and gradually increase the amount until you feed 100% of the new diet.
